Create a new Controller object
public controller ( string $viewName, array $config = [] ) : |
||
$viewName | string | The name of the view we're getting a Controller for. |
$config | array | Optional MVC configuration values for the Controller object. |
return |
/** * Create a new Controller object * * @param string $viewName The name of the view we're getting a Controller for. * @param array $config Optional MVC configuration values for the Controller object. * * @return Controller */ public function controller($viewName, array $config = array()) { try { return parent::controller($viewName, $config); } catch (ControllerNotFound $e) { $magic = new Magic\ControllerFactory($this->container); return $magic->make($viewName, $config); } }
